Riders Chase Edison in orthern Division Race When the practices began, we Worked harder than ever before . Base stealing and backing up other positions were two points highly emphasized. As the season began, all the long practices paid off. We beat teams which clobbered us only one short year before . Many games were won on the basepaths. We forced our opponents to make mis- takes. After our first couple of wins, we gained confidence in ourselves. We had to believe in ourselves to be winners, and that's what we did. With all this aggressiveness and competitiveness we finished in second place in the Northern Di- vision of the Firelands Conference . We had the best record a Rough- rider baseball team has had in '1' '11 quite a while. BELOW: At the Fall Banquet Jeanne Burke presems a scrapbook to Coach Gallagher. thletes Dash for Lasagna at Awards Banquets Participating in our school's athletic and cheerleading pro- gram guarantees you an invitation to the Winter and Spring Sports Banquets. Food! Man, there sure is a lot of food to choose from. Everyone brings a couple of dishes along with their parents . There always seems to be a mad dash for the lasagna when we line up to get our meal. During the Winter Sports Ban- quet the lights went out during the 110 latter part of it. It Was funny be- cause Mr. Ferres was running around with a flashlight telling all of us, Just remember, I know all your voices . The senior boys received scrapbooks from cheerleaders, mat-maids and some of the other girls. That's a really nice gesture, because the books contain a lot of memories . Even though the track and baseball teams don't have an awards banquet, they have a pic- nic after their seasons are com- pleted. Spring sports awards are given at the annual Awards As- sembly which is attended by the student body. It is really a thrill to be a re- cipient of one of the big awards like MVP, Most Improved, or the 11006 Award. I have always enjoyed these evenis because it leaves me with a lot more pride.52
